Thumbs Up! 4+ out of 5

Saw it last weekend with my wife. Solid Pixar entry, although not quite up to the gold standard of Toy Story or Finding Nemo. There's some really good bits. It actually feels more like a James Bond movie than a Superhero film though. It does feel a bit slow at points in comparison with other Pixar movies.

Don't bother waiting till the end of the credits -- there's no easter eggs in the credits.
